--- Quote from: Trail Duty on November 07, 2013, 01:43:03 PM ---Nice write-up Ryan, thanks! Beginning to lean towards the relocation rather than the skid, seems cheaper and more effective. So the Jeep didn't throw any codes after the relocation? I've heard that can happen.
--- End quote ---
On the contrary, before i did the relocate, mine was throwing a code. Once I finished the code went away. I believe the source was a leaking hose, (a small crack or something) Replacing it with a thicker and more pliable hose I believe cured that.
RD Slyter:
Something i noticed, you mite want to start with 6 feet of hose rather than 4, allowing for an extra foot for each one. Giving you just a little extra. We all know its better to have and not need.... //salute//
